My Asian family and I saw the positive reviews for Little Szechuan Restaurant and tried it for take out dinner. We ordered wor wonton soup, chicken broccoli dinner plate with fried rice, egg rolls, Dan Dan Noodles, Tofu Eggplant. About $50 worth of food. Wait time was long, nice woman said because food is made fresh. Ok.
Large Wonton soup was bland and flavorless, small size, NOT quart size as ordered but pint size. Chicken Broccoli plate was was so bland and weird. Chicken broccoli was cubed with congealed sauce, a scoop of it in a corner. Fried rice was just plain rice, dyed brown with soy sauce, no egg or vegetables mixed in, just plain rice bland. Plain Lo mein noodles were on the plate too, not sure why, but bland fat udon noodles. Weird.
Dan Dan noodles were spicy, but again with the cubed chicken and frozen peas and carrots mixed in. Definitely not authentic.
Large Tofu eggplant was only a PINT size bland, swimming in a congealed sauce with more frozen peas and carrots. Everyone was just perplexed, confused, disappointed and frustrated by the positive comments and reviews. We just wanted some good simple Chinese food after a long drive to our hotel. Very bland food and very disappointed family.
